Manufacturing, Purity, and Safety Concerns Why manufacturing matters BPC-157 is made using a complex chemical process involving: Synthetic amino acids (Fmoc-protected amino acids) Polymer resins (Rink, Wang, or PAL resin) Aggressive solvents (DMF, DCM) Reactive coupling agents (HATU, HBTU, DIC, PyBOP) Strong acids (TFA) HPLC chemicals and stabilizers In pharmaceutical-grade production, these chemicals are removed to trace levels through validated purification steps and quality control testing
